Egg hats.

Something silly I crocheted in a spare 5 mins before bed. Easy chain 6 then complete circle, continue with doubles for 2 rows then trebles for 5 rows. Add alternate colour or texture for final row and a little matching bobble!!!!

Kept the girl entertained, Cinderella now has a new hat!!!!
